The U.S. government subsidizes a wide range of programs and sectors to citizens, promote economic stability, and encourage certain behaviors or outcomes. Major areas include:

1. Healthcare

Medicare: Health insurance for seniors (65+) and certain disabled individuals.

Medicaid: Health coverage for low-income individuals and families.

Affordable Care Act (ACA) subsidies: Helps people afford health insurance on the marketplace.


2. Food Assistance

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P): Commonly known as food stamps.

WIC (Women, Infants, and Children): Nutritional for pregnant women and young children.

School Lunch and Breakfast Programs: Free or reduced-cost meals for students.


3. Housing

Section 8 Housing Vouchers: Helps low-income families afford rent in the private market.

Public Housing: Government-owned housing for low-income individuals.

Homeless assistance programs: Grants to combat homelessness.


4. Education

Federal Student Loans and Grants: Pell Grants and subsidized loans for college students.

Head Start: Early childhood education for low-income families.

K–12 funding: Title I funds for schools with high percentages of low-income students.


5. Energy and Utilities

Low Income Home Energy Assistance Program (LIHEAP): Helps with heating and cooling bills.

Subsidies for renewable energy: Tax credits and grants for solar, wind, etc.

Fossil fuel subsidies: Though controversial, oil and gas industries also receive subsidies.


6. Agriculture

Farm subsidies: for crop insurance, price s, and direct payments to farmers.



7. Transportation

Public transit subsidies: Federal grants to cities for buses, subways, etc.

Highway construction and maintenance: Funded through gas taxes and federal grants.



8. Unemployment and Income

Unemployment insurance: Payments for workers who lose jobs through no fault of their own.

Earned Income Tax Credit (EITC) and Child Tax Credit: Refundable credits for low- to moderate-income workers.


9. Business and Industry

Small Business istration (SBA) loans and grants

R & D tax credits: Especially in tech, biotech, and defense sectors.
